In every stage of my studies there are some one or the other favorite teacher to me
so In my 8th class, sreedevi mam. she is a biology teacher. If she once teaches us subject, we won't forget it. there will be no necessary to take book before exams. and in 9th class srinivas sir. He is our maths sir. He used to teach maths very well. He has a great credit for my maths marks in tenth. I am a very poor in maths. He only guided me which questions are important and how to prepare, and finally i scored 70 marks. He is a well decent person.
In my intermediate, there is english mam, she teaches english in such a way there is no need to refer the subject again.
and in my engineering, sharekhan sir. He looks so smart and hand some. All girls used to follow him and even they are very crazy about him. But he is some thing like women hater. I used to admire him for his pain of teaching. He always want his students to compulsoryly pass the exam. Once in my first year engineering, he took lab exam of 6 hours. as he want everyone to pass the lab exam. He just gave the question and asked us to try it on the computer and get the output. He may be harsh with the students but his motto is really appreciable. On that year, in other computer departments many have failed, but the students of him have all passed with good marks. Recently I saw him in mall, but he didnt recognize me.
